I'm kind of stuck in two projects at work, but could someone post every OL that we've drafted since Ted came aboard?

"Zero2Cool" wrote:



Sure thing:

Junius Coston - C/G - Round 5 - 2005
Will Whitticker - G - Round 7 - 2005
Daryn Colledge - G - Round 2 - 2006
Jason Spitz - G - Round 3 - 2006
Tony Moll - OT - Round 5 - 2006
Allen Barbre - OT - Round 4 - 2007
Josh Sitton - G - Round 4 - 2008
Breno Giacomini - OT - Round 5 - 2008
T.J. Lang - OT - Round 4 - 2009
Jamon Meredith - OT - Round 5 - 2009
Bryan Bulaga - OT - Round 1 - 2010
Marshall Newhouse - G/OT - Round 5 - 2010

Whether it's the GM or the OL coach, I have to say this does not look good at all.

By being unbalanced we allowed the DE to set up wide.. they didn't have to worry about the run.. and gave the whole advantage to the DE in the match up.. as a tackle when you have to remain in a close gap and on the LOS scrimmage you are beat more often from the start than not.. don't care whom you are as a tackle.

When the DE sets up wide.. your first drop step as a offensive tackle has to be a deep one.. and giving up balance in order to do so.. that opens up both the outside edge and inside edge up for the DE to attack.. you by alignment as a tackle are off balance from the snap.. and facing a guy, when motivated, like Peppers that type of advantage.. you as that DE better win that battle more often than not..

Pissed me off that we didn't run more guard/tackle or off tackle draws to alter that attack.. MM has got to look back to last season and figure out that we didn't start to dominate defenses until we established balance in the play calling and helping our aging and young tackles out.
